I'm still researching too but, there seems to be a few different ways to do this.
First, you can buy the adapter harness online (Nelson, Blackbear, ect).
1. You have the smaller radiator in your truck so you can use the electric fans from a 4th generation fbody.
2. You can install the bigger radiator and fans out of a 2005 and newer Silverado. Keep in mind that these trucks came with a higher output alternator to drive these fans.
I have read that people have swapped to the 05 fan setup and not changed alternators and had no problems...
Try searching. It's covered here and on several other websites.

As stated above there are a few options. You can go with LS1 fans, switch to an 05+ setup and get the bigger 34" rad and efans or go after marker with a flex a lite setup or similar. You will need a harness for the LS1 and 05+ efans, some of the aftermarket stuff comes with a VSC controller which are junk most of the time. With most options tho you'll need someone to tune your PCM to activate the fans.

Two ground wires go into the PCM. If you buy a harness, the proper PCM pins should be included. When the PCM wants the fans to come on, it grounds the pin(s). There's a nice diagram on here somewhere that I used.
You will need a tune to activate the pins and set the parameters. It won't just plug and play on an 02.
